New smartphone user here. Trying to figure out why anyone would activate wifi and deplete their battery when they could use the verizon network? What's the benefit to wifi?
Well not only does WiFi offer faster speeds and not use the data in your coverage, but I use WiFI when I am at my office.
I am in IT so sometimes I need to perform functions on the network or remote into my computer. Being on Wifi allows me to access basic company resources even when I am in the office, but away from my desk.
You will notice that Wifi speeds are faster than the Verizon 3G as well so sometimes that is why people use it.
